§ 39-06-26 — Reporting convictions, suspensions, or revocations of nonresidents

Text
1.Upon receiving a record of the conviction or adjudication in this state of a nonresident
driver of a motor vehicle of any offense under the motor vehicle laws of this state, or
an equivalent ordinance, the director may notify the licensing authority in the state in
which the nonresident resides or is licensed.
2.If a nonresident's operating privilege is suspended or revoked under the law of this
state, the director shall notify the licensing authority in the state in which the
nonresident resides or is licensed.
